  Lithium iron phosphate battery is a lithium-ion battery that uses lithium iron phosphate (LiFePO4) as the positive electrode material and carbon as the negative electrode material. The rated voltage of the monomer is 3.2V, and the charging cut-off voltage is 3.6V-3.65V. During the charging process, some lithium ions in lithium iron phosphate are removed and transferred to the negative electrode through the electrolyte, which is embedded in the negative electrode carbon material; At the same time, electrons are released from the positive electrode and reach the negative electrode from the external circuit, maintaining the balance of chemical reactions. During the discharge process, lithium ions detach from the negative electrode and reach the positive electrode through the electrolyte. At the same time, the negative electrode releases electrons, which reach the positive electrode from the external circuit and provide energy to the outside world.

  Lithium iron phosphate batteries have the advantages of high working voltage, high energy density, long cycle life, good safety performance, low self discharge rate, and no memory effect.

  1. Lithium iron phosphate battery voltage

  The nominal voltage of a single lithium iron phosphate battery is 3.2V, the charging voltage is 3.6V, and the discharge cut-off voltage is 2.0V. The lithium iron phosphate battery pack achieves the required voltage for the equipment through the series combination of battery cells, and the battery pack voltage is N * the number of series connections. There are several commonly used voltages for lithium iron phosphate battery packs:

  12V lithium iron phosphate battery

  24V lithium iron phosphate battery

  36V lithium iron phosphate battery

  48V lithium iron phosphate battery

  2. Lithium iron phosphate battery capacity

  The capacity of a lithium iron phosphate battery pack is determined based on the capacity and number of battery cells connected in parallel, usually according to the specific requirements of the electrical equipment. The more lithium iron phosphate cells are connected in parallel, the greater the capacity. Common lithium iron phosphate battery packs have capacities of 10ah, 20ah, 40ah, 50ah, 100ah, 200ah, 400ah, etc.
